WEICHAI NECV Launches LANDKING X7 Light Truck in Fujian, China
On September 15, WEICHAI New Energy Commercial Vehicle officially launched the LANDKING X7, its latest premium light truck, in Fujian, China. The model targets the growing need for cleaner, more efficient logistics in China.

Designed for Fujian’s hilly terrain and demanding roads, the LANDKING X7 delivers strong power, long range, and high load capacity.Available in electric, fuel, and hybrid versions, the truck offers customers flexible choiceswhile ensuring reliable, efficient, and comfortable operation through advanced technology.
According to Yu Lang, General Manager of WEICHAI NECV, the LANDKING X7 electric model blends sleek styling, extended driving range, heavy-duty load capability, safety, comfort, and smart features—setting a new benchmark for light trucks in China.
The LANDKING X7 electric model offers multiple battery options (140–200 kWh) and supports 2C fast charging. It is built on WEICHAI’s ‘Stellar Super Electric Power Platform,’ enhanced through collaboration with top global partners including INOVANCE, Bosch, and HanDe Axle. A lifetime battery warranty for the first owner helps cut long-term maintenance and operating costs.
In pre-launch testing, the truck completed a full-load run from Fuzhou to Quanzhou, China, covering 508 km under demanding conditions—including highway driving at an average speed of 90 km/h with the air conditioning on. Under typical mixed driving conditions, the truck can cover up to 560 km on a single charge, and under ideal conditions, its range can extend to 600 km, demonstrating both reliability and long-distance capability for real-world logistics operations.
Yu Lang also personally tested the truck on highways, steep slopes, and urban roads. The tests showed it can deliver up to 500 N·m of torque, maintain steady load performance, and offer smooth handling—making it well-suited for a wide range of logistics operations.
The LANDKING X7 also prioritizes driver comfort. Highlights include a spacious 2120 mm-wide cabin, user-friendly column shifter, L2+ driver assistance, a 360-degree camera system, and a sleeper bed with a “sleep mode” for better rest. Together, these features enhance safety, convenience, and comfort in everyday use.
With WEICHAI’s nationwide service network and the lifetime battery warranty, customers can benefit from reliable support—whether for city deliveries or long-haul logistics.

At the launch event, several logistics companies signed purchase agreements for the LANDKING X7, underscoring strong market confidence in the new model. As Yu Lang noted, the LANDKING X7 marks a major step in WEICHAI NECV’s journey to become China’s leading light truck brand. The company will continue driving advances in efficiency, lower operating costs, and new energy technologies to support the logistics industry’s shift to a greener, smarter future.
